Miguel Esteves Cardoso

Miguel Esteves Cardoso is a Portuguese writer, translator, critic, and journalist known for his work in literature and media. He has contributed to various newspapers and magazines and is recognized for his witty and insightful commentary on Portuguese culture and society.
